At the Kennedy Space Center: What’s on the Agenda?
Rocket Garden Tour
Your first stop is the Rocket Garden, located right at the entrance. Here, you’ll find a display of various rockets launched by NASA across decades. It’s a visual feast that instantly puts you in the mood for space exploration, and it’s a great way to understand how far technology has come. One reviewer notes that seeing the “types of rockets launched by NASA since the beginning of the space conquest” is both inspiring and humbling.
Shuttle Atlantis Exhibit
Next, you’ll explore the Shuttle Atlantis Hall, which is more than just a static display. This exhibit provides a retrospective of NASA’s Shuttle program with detailed explanations and multimedia presentations. It’s an engaging way to understand the complexity of human spaceflight and the Shuttle’s pivotal role. Visitors often comment that this part of the tour offers a deep appreciation for the Shuttle’s contributions, and it’s suitable for both enthusiasts and casual visitors alike.
The Saturn V Hall & Bus Ride
A highlight for many is the bus journey to the Saturn V Hall—a ride that itself is narrated with screens inside that relive the history of the American space race. You’ll get to approach the iconic launch pads, which remain powerful symbols of human ambition. One traveler mentions that “the bus ride is an opportunity to approach the mythical launch pads from which the pioneers of space launched,” making it a truly memorable experience.

Is transportation included in the tour? Yes, private air-conditioned transportation is provided from Orlando to the Kennedy Space Center and back.
What is the meeting time? The tour starts at 9:00 am, with pickup from your designated meeting point in Orlando.
Are tickets to the Kennedy Space Center included? Yes, all admission tickets are included in the price.
How long is the tour? The entire experience lasts about 7 hours, allowing ample time for exploration and travel.
Is the tour suitable for children? While not explicitly stated, the structured itinerary and educational content make it suitable for families, especially those interested in space.
Can I cancel the tour? Yes, cancellations are free up to 24 hours before the start, with a full refund.
What should I bring? Comfortable clothing, a camera, and water bottles are recommended. Bottled water is provided.
Is this a private tour? Yes, only your group will participate, providing a personalized experience.
